Transaction ad2c62a3c5f106a043c6754d68f392de34fa8d34680f07b31b19db871feed2b4

1 Input
1 Outputs
  • ad2c62a3c5f106a043c6754d68f392de34fa8d34680f07b31b19db871feed2b4:0
  • value  2063756
    address  32f6N8PLfqn9DfimsGgLBCcuo7fBpo14cL